RICHMOND METRO HABITAT FOR HUMANITY, founded in 1986, is a community nonprofit in the Housing & Shelter sector that reported $5.9M in total revenue in fiscal year 2018. Revenue surged 37% from the prior year, signaling strong growth momentum.

Mission

RICHMOND METRO HABITAT FOR HUMANITY BRINGS PEOPLE TOGETHER TO BUILD HOMES, COMMUNITIES, AND HOPE.
